The 8 Layers: A Comprehensive Framework

  1. Layer 1: Phonemes and Allophones - The building blocks of sound
  2. Layer 2: Syllable Structure - The rhythm of language
  3. Layer 3: Intonation Patterns - The melody of speech
  4. Layer 4: Lexical Tone - The color of meaning
  5. Layer 5: Phonological Processes - The rules of sound manipulation
  6. Layer 6: Morphology - The shape of words
  7. Layer 7: Syntax - The grammar of language
  8. Layer 8: Pragmatics - The art of communication
